Overview of Stoic Philosophy
Stoic philosophy emphasizes resilience, virtue, and the pursuit of wisdom. It offers practical guidance for navigating life's challenges and stresses the importance of inner strength.
Key Principles of Stoicism
-
Virtue as the Highest Good: Stoics believe that virtue—character traits like wisdom, courage, justice, and temperance—represents the ultimate goal in life. Achieving virtues leads to a fulfilling life.
-
Control and Acceptance: Distinguishing between what lies within our control and what doesn't is vital. Stoics advocate focusing on our responses to external events rather than the events themselves.
-
Emotional Resilience: Emotions stem from our judgments. By adjusting our perceptions, we can cultivate peace and maintain equilibrium through life's ups and downs.
-
Universal Reason: Stoics view the universe as a rational order governed by reason. Aligning oneself with this rationality fosters a harmonious existence.
-
Practice of Mindfulness: Regular reflection enhances self-awareness. Stoics engage in daily practices, like journaling, to cultivate mindfulness and assess their thoughts and actions.
Historical Context
Zeno of Citium established stoicism in ancient Greece in the third century BCE. Seneca, Epictetus, and Marcus Aurelius are important individuals who advanced its ideas. In ancient Rome, stoicism rose to popularity and had a lasting impact on leaders and intellectuals. Numerous people have been motivated to seek a meaningful life by its emphasis on ethics and reason, which has remained relevant.
